Remarks
To be admitted to my college one must take the AEEE exam conducted by our university to check the eligibility for each course based on our ranks. To apply for this exam one must fill up the application form online by registering through our e-mail ID. And the application fee is about 600 Rs for each individual.It is held in two phases and the best one will be selected and the rank will announced according to one percentile. It is held in the months of January to May of the year.

Fees and Financial Aid
The annual fee is 270000. The fee structure is somewhat higher compared to TNEA colleges but the standard of teaching and job opportunities further matches the fees appropriately. I got placed in the CSE department in the 4 slab scholarship.
